The big thing I like about the Wellie Wisher line is that everything seems so well designed and easy to use. The Winter Friends Skating Outfit is no exception!
The outfit consists of five pieces: a berry-colored jacket, light blue pants, white skates with pink accents, white mittens and a white headband.
Headband: This is the only piece I didn't use, as I liked Emerson's hair in the meet-style. It is well-made out of thick 'cuddle cloth' material.
Jacket: The jacket is made from a scroapy material- maybe taffeta - in a berry color. If you have Emerson, it matches the hair bands and 'poofs' from her meet outfit. Anywhoo, it pulls on like a, well, jacket, and closes with a piece of velcro that runs length-wise down the front of the jacket. It was very easy to put on and close, but my Em has easy-to-move joints.
Pants: The pants are made from a light blue nylon-like material, with embroidered silver snowflakes down the outside of the legs. They have an elastic waist. Once again, they were easy to put on, but Em has no joint issues.
Skates: The skates are made of plastic with the details painted on. I question the longevity of the paint, but we shall see. Each skate has two blades, so it's easier for the doll to stand. I was a little worried about these, as the opening looks kinda small, but they slipped on without issue.
Mittens: The mittens are made of the same white 'cuddle cloth' as the headband, but they are embroidered with little black bunny(?) faces. There are no pockets for fingers or thumbs, just one big open space to put the Wellie Wishers' hand in. I will admit I had a little trouble getting these on - they kept getting tangled in her fingers! However, I think this was user-error and not the fault of the product. Once again, they were very well made.
Overall, it's a darling outfit for the Wellie's that fits perfectly and is well made.
